Are people in Bern older or younger than people in Wien?
- The Median Age in Bern is 9.8 years older than in Wien.
Are housing costs cheaper in Bern or Wien?
- Bern
housing
costs are 44.9% more expensive than Wien hous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Bern or Wien?
- The average commute for residents of Bern is 4.8 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Wien.
